Before placing shingles on a roof roofers determine the total area to be covered and divide by 100 the area of a square to determine the total number of bundles needed to complete the job. 100 square feet is called a square. Find the total square footage of your roof by multiplying the width by the length and then divide that number by 100 and you will get the number of squares you need to cover. 100 sq ft 21 shingles per bundle.
The number of square feet in a bundle is printed on the paper or plastic packaging that covers the bundle. Be sure to add a couple of bundles for double first row and capping. Each square will need three bundles of shingles to cover it. Each plywood sheet is 4 x 8 feet or 32 square feet which coincidentally is almost exactly equivalent to the coverage of one bundle of traditional three tab shingles.

As a rule of thumb there are 3 bundles to a square assuming that you are using three tab strip shingles. You will find roof shingles sold by the bundle and by the square. A square is the number of shingles it would take to cover 100 square feet of roof area with each row of shingles covering the tabs of the layer below it. 3 bundles per square.
